About

P Montenero is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Epidemiology and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, P Montenero has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 356 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Pharmacology, 3 papers in Epidemiology and 3 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in P Montenero’s work include Spatial Neglect and Hemispheric Dysfunction (3 papers), Hyperglycemia and glycemic control in critically ill and hospitalized patients (1 paper) and Flavonoids in Medical Research (1 paper). P Montenero is often cited by papers focused on Spatial Neglect and Hemispheric Dysfunction (3 papers), Hyperglycemia and glycemic control in critically ill and hospitalized patients (1 paper) and Flavonoids in Medical Research (1 paper). P Montenero collaborates with scholars based in Italy. P Montenero's co-authors include Carmelina Razzano, Anna Judica, Pierluigi Zoccolotti, Gabriella Antonucci, L. Pizzamiglio, G. Nolfe, Salvatore Giaquinto, Adria Colletti and Alessandro Colletti and has published in prestigious journals such as Acta Neurologica Scandinavica, Acta Diabetologica and International Journal of Neuroscience.
